The Itatuba City Hall has opened registration for a public competition offering 83 positions with salaries ranging from R$ 1,621 to R$ 12,500.
The Itatuba City Hall in Paraíba, Brazil, has announced the opening of applications for a public competition, which will offer a total of 83 positions across various job levels from fundamental to superior. The salaries for these roles vary significantly, starting at R$ 1,621 for lower-level positions and going up to R$ 12,500 for higher qualifications, indicating a diverse range of opportunities depending on applicants' skills and experiences.
The available positions include roles such as Community Health Agent, Endemic Disease Agent, Administrative Assistant, various medical roles including Family Health physicians, and technical appointments such as Electricians and Dentists. Applications can be submitted until March 29 on the website of the organizing consultancy, Ápice Consultoria, underscoring the municipal effort to fill critical roles within the community that may enhance public services and healthcare.
